Indhold: |
Species’ distribution and abundance from community to global scale:
Basics: Species concepts, Biomes, Biogeography
The role of history, evolution, climate, climate change and biotic interactions in shaping diversity patterns
Spatial diversity gradients: Area, Latitude, Altitude/depth, Isolation, Habitat diversity, Productivity
Temporal diversity gradients: Geological, Geomorphological, Historical, Evolutionary and Ecological time scales
Community scale: Niches, Filters, Competition, Mutualism, Disturbance, Succession, Species pools
Macro scale: Diversity-stability, Diversity-productivity, Equilibrium theory, Geometrical constraints, Vicariance, Speciation
Testing: Experimentation, Simulation, Null models

Målbeskrivelse: |
The students should acquire ability to:
identify and describe diversity patterns from local to global scale
suggest and investigate possible diversity pattern-shaping mechanisms
evaluate, compare and elaborate theories behind diversity patterns
apply and interpret relevant statistical tools and tests
contribute on a scientific basis to debates concerning management of biodiversity in light of global changes in land-use and climate.
The grade 12 will given to solutions that fully demonstrate mastership of the abilities in the competence list, combined with some original approaches. To obtain the grade 02 the solution must at least demonstrate knowledge to basic principles and approaches according to the subjects in the list.
